Why think secondhand?
Choosing secondhand for some is all about saving money, but there are other wins too
♻️ Keep useful things in circulation rather than sending them to landfill.
🌏 Reduce the resources needed for new products – including raw materials, energy and water.
💚 Reduce waste and our environmental footprint by making the most of what already exists.
🛠️ Support a repair, reuse and reuse-again mindset rather than a buy-and-discard culture.
💰 Save money – and sometimes you can find something much more interesting than you would in a regular shop!
🏘️ Support local community organisations and businesses when you shop locally.
✨ And perhaps most importantly, secondhand makes us stop and think: Do I really need something new? Could I borrow it, repair it, swap it or find it secondhand instead?
